Role Summary

The Technical Writer for Automotive ECU Validation is responsible for creating, organizing, and maintaining high quality technical documentation that supports the validation and verification of Electronic Control Units (ECUs). This role acts as a bridge between test engineers, software/hardware teams, suppliers, and OEM stakeholders to ensure clarity, compliance, and traceability across the validation lifecycle.

Key Responsibilities
  • Documentation Development
    • Create and maintain test plans, test procedures, test reports, traceability matrices, and validation summaries.
  • Translate engineering inputs (requirements, test data, Jira issues, Vector tools output) into clear, structured documents aligned with OEM standards.
  • Develop DFMEA/PFMEA supporting docs, validation compliance checklists, and safety related documentation (ASIL A-D where applicable).
  • Requirements & Traceability
    • Interpret system, software, and hardware requirements from DOORS, Jama, or Polarion.
    • Map validation test cases to requirements ensuring full coverage and compliance.
    • Work closely with functional safety teams to align documentation with ISO 26262 processes.
  • Test Artifacts & Evidence Management
    • Convert raw test logs (CANoe/CANalyzer, INCA, ETAS tools, scripts) into readable, engineering grade evidence.
    • Ensure standardized formatting, version control, and metadata tagging across all validation artifacts.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ration
    • Work with validation engineers, calibration teams, software developers, and program managers.
    • Participate in design reviews, validation reviews, and stakeholder meetings to gather documentation requirements.
    • Support suppliers in aligning their deliverables with OEM documentation expectations.
  • Compliance & Process Adherence
    • Ensure documentation follows automotive standards such as:
    • ISO 26262 (Functional Safety)
    • ASPICE
    • SAE J1939 / CAN
    • OEM-specific documentation guidelines (e.g., Ford, GM, Stellantis, Rivian, Nissan)
    • Maintain consistency across documentation repositories (SharePoint, Confluence, Git Lab, or PLM systems).
